Choosing the Right Dog Park: Areas & Offerings

Finding a dog park that's a wonderful fit for your furry friend involves more than just location; it's about the available grounds and the offerings they provide. Consider the size of the enclosure – is it large enough for playful dogs to run freely? Many parks offer separate sections for tiny and giant breeds, which is check here a crucial consideration for safety. Look for necessary features like potable water stations, garbage bag dispensers, and shaded areas. Some grounds even boast extras such as obstacle equipment, benches for guardians, and even barriers that are exceptionally safe. A well-maintained place is also key; regular maintenance and visible signage contribute to a positive experience for everyone.
